NAME

       Rex::Config - Handles the configuration.

DESCRIPTION

       This module holds all configuration parameters for Rex.

       With this module you can specify own configuration parameters for your modules.

EXPORTED METHODS

   register_set_handler($handler_name, $code)
       Register a handler that gets called by set.

        Rex::Config->register_set_handler("foo", sub {
          my ($value) = @_;
          print "The user set foo -> $value\n";
        });

       And now you can use this handler in your Rexfile like this:

        set foo => "bar";

   register_config_handler($topic, $code)
       With this function it is possible to register own sections in the users config file
       ($HOME/.rex/config.yml).

       Example:

        Rex::Config->register_config_handler("foo", sub {
         my ($param) = @_;
         print "bar is: " . $param->{bar} . "\n";
        });

       And now the user can set this in his configuration file:

        base:
          user: theuser
          password: thepassw0rd
        foo:
          bar: baz
